Sex After Joint Replacement Surgery is a topic that makes people uncomfortable, but it’s a important to talk about. You can expect a period of time after surgery where you’re not going to be physically able to have sex. After this period, there’s going to be a period where you can but you just have to be cautious. Use a common sense approach with sexual activity.
